What is the testing principle of 18650 lithium 3.7 battery separator technology? What are its detection methods?
18650 lithium 3.7 battery separator technology testing principle
The principle of online detection of diaphragm thickness is mainly to convert the attenuation of rays after passing through the diaphragm into diaphragm thickness. This means that the accuracy and stability of the detection must be ensured during the detection process.
As the energy density of lithium batteries increases, the separator of the battery becomes thinner and thinner, and the measurement accuracy is also required to be higher and higher. Generally, enterprises use micrometers for measurement, and there are also GB/T6672-2001 Plastic Film and Sheet Thickness Determination_Mechanical Measurement Method. A standard measurement method, there are also corresponding international standards for measurement, but these standards are not formulated for diaphragms, so there are problems such as wide test range and low accuracy. Therefore, companies that require accuracy generally use precision thickness gauges for measurement.
What are the testing methods for 18650 lithium 3.7 battery separator technology?
1.Thickness
There are two main online control technologies for 18650 lithium 3.7 battery separator thickness, one is MD (vertical) control and CD (transverse) control; the other is separator online machine vision inspection technology. The so-called MD control and CD control refer to the closed-loop thickness control in the MD direction by controlling the feeding screw speed or traction speed; and the data measurement through the scanning frame, and finally the closed-loop data control in the CD direction.
2. Curvature
Some companies also call it camber, which refers to the arc produced after slitting the 18650 lithium 3.7 battery separator. When the arc is obvious, it will cause the laminations to be uneven, and create a vortex during winding, causing the pole pieces to be exposed and cause short circuits. The test method is to lay the diaphragm strip flat on the table and compare the parallelism with the edge of the steel ruler to get the curvature of the diaphragm.
3. Breathability
The time required for a certain volume of air to pass through the diaphragm under certain conditions is also called the Gurley value. Its size has a certain impact on the performance of lithium batteries. The ASTM test method is generally used.
4.Porosity
The volume of the void accounts for the proportion of the entire volume. The test methods include the liquid absorption calculation method and the test method. The liquid absorption calculation method is to immerse the 18650 lithium 3.7 battery separator in a known solvent, and calculate the amount of the separator occupied by the liquid by measuring the mass difference before and after the separator is infiltrated. Void volume, mercury intrusion testing method uses external force to apply pressure on the diaphragm to press mercury into the pores of the diaphragm, and then calculates the porosity of the diaphragm by measuring the volume of mercury pressed into the diaphragm. After multiple measurements, the average value is taken.
